Söderhamn is a locality and the seat of Söderhamn Municipality, Gävleborg County, Sweden with 11,761 inhabitants in 2010.The most popular tourist attraction is Oscarsborg, a tower built in 1895 on the top of a hill close to the town centre. The tower was built as a memorial of a visit of king Oscar II of Sweden. The king actually never visited Söderhamn.

  • 1. Falu Gruva Falun
    Falun Mine was a mine in Falun, Sweden, that operated for a millennium from the 10th century to 1992. It produced as much as two thirds of Europe's copper needs and helped fund many of Sweden's wars in the 17th century. Technological developments at the mine had a profound influence on mining globally for two centuries. The mine is now a museum and in 2001 was designated a UNESCO world heritage site.
